Handover note — Crumbwheel order cutoffs.

Welcome aboard. The bakery cutoff rule in Crumbwheel closes same-day orders at 14:00 local to each storefront, not UTC — this has bitten us twice. Holiday overrides live in the calendar service and take precedence silently, so always check there first when a cutoff looks wrong. To unlock the calendar service's admin console after a restart, enter the recovery passphrase below.

vault phrase of bagap-bahaf = silion-pelox-sorox-casdor-quenwyn-fraax-eliox-praael-kelion-quenvan-kasox-rusael-norius-belvan

**Q: Why does the Quillport CSV import wizard reject files with BOM markers?**

Known issue since v3.2. The parser treats the BOM as part of the first header name, so column mapping fails silently. Workaround: strip the BOM before upload, or use the "raw mode" toggle under Advanced. Fix is scheduled for the Harkwell sprint. Don't advise customers to re-save in legacy encodings — that breaks delimiter detection. If you hit a case that isn't BOM-related, send the sample file to the imports crew.

escalation mailbox, bafog-fafog: ulador@paliqlabs.internal

Failed exports from the Wrenhollow reporting service are safe to retry, but follow the sequence carefully. First, confirm the failure reason in the export log—most failures are transient storage timeouts and resolve on a single retry. Use the retry command with the original export ID so the system deduplicates output; never create a fresh export for the same window, as this can double-bill downstream consumers. Retry at most twice. If the third attempt fails, stop and contact the exports maintainer.

escalation mailbox, kadup-fajof: ulador@qirvanlabs.corp